Exeter Twp., PA (January 14, 2025) – Emergency responders attended a multi-vehicle accident on Tuesday afternoon on 422 WB under the E Neversink Overpass in Exeter Township. The crash resulted in injuries to several individuals involved.
The incident occurred mid-afternoon, prompting a quick response from Exeter Township Fire and Rescue and local paramedics. Multiple vehicles were reported to have collided, causing traffic disruptions along 422 WB. Emergency crews provided care to injured victims on-site before some were transported to nearby medical facilities for further evaluation and treatment.
As of now, authorities have not disclosed the total number of individuals affected or the severity of their injuries. The cause of the crash is under investigation, with local law enforcement working to determine contributing factors such as road conditions or driver actions.
